Firstly, this book needs editing. Lots of it. Why? Her hair color changes between black and brown... There are words just sitting there, meaning nothing and totally out of place (I'm guessing it was edited to change certain words to reduce repetition, but they seem to have forgotten to delete the words they wanted to change), Julie seems to turn and talk to Julie, Taylor seems to be talking to Taylor.. And I swear at one point something happens (A) and then other stuff happens leaving us 2 days away from A and then when she's speaking to her friends A was suddenly yesterday.
The story wasn't all that and this little editing gone wrong just ruined it all. I kept being thrown out of the zone.. Re-reading, going back to see if I had missed something.. This book is a hot mess.
